2014-06-05 4 views
-1

J'utilise VS2013 sur Windows 7 64bit, j'ai lu ce sujet http://www.dreamincode.net/forums/topic/148707-introduction-to-using-libusb-10/page__hl__USB
et essayer de le compiler sur VS2013, mais j'avoir problème.
message d'erreur est la compilation ici:Utilisation Libusb dans Visual Studio 2013

Error 12 error LNK1120: 8 unresolved externals C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\Debug\LIBUSB.exe LIBUSB 

Error 4 error LNK2019: unresolved external symbol [email protected] referenced in function _wmain C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Error 5 error LNK2019: unresolved external symbol [email protected] referenced in function _wmain C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Error 6 error LNK2019: unresolved external symbol [email protected] referenced in function _wmain C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Error 7 error LNK2019: unresolved external symbol [email protected] referenced in function _wmain C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 
Error 8 error LNK2019: unresolved external symbol [email protected] referenced in function _wmain C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Error 9 error LNK2019: unresolved external symbol [email protected] referenced in function "void __cdecl printdev(struct libusb_device *)" ([email protected]@[email protected]@@Z) C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Error 10 error LNK2019: unresolved external symbol [email protected] referenced in function "void __cdecl printdev(struct libusb_device *)" ([email protected]@[email protected]@@Z) C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Error 11 error LNK2019: unresolved external symbol [email protected] referenced in function "void __cdecl printdev(struct libusb_device *)" ([email protected]@[email protected]@@Z) C:\Users\HoangNam\Documents\Visual Studio 2013\Projects\LIBUSB\LIBUSB\LIBUSB.obj LIBUSB 

Je pense que je dois lien usblib à mon projet, mais je ne sais pas comment faire.
Pls me aider :(

+0

Did Vous devez inclure libusb.lib? –

+0

Doit être inclus comme: Propriétés du projet -> Lieur -> Entrée [dépendances supplémentaires] – Andro

+0

Je ne trouve pas libusb.lib dans le dossier libusb 1.0.18, donc je ne peux pas l'inclure – HoangNam

Répondre

2

La solution doit être ouverte à partir msvc dossier et construit. Ensuite, il y aura .lib & .dll fichiers dont vous avez besoin. Copiez-projet et ajouter le dossier comme l'a dit Andro. Il fonctionne.